What affects the price

When you look at garage door repairs, the total cost depends on a few moving parts. The main factors are the type of door you have, the specific hardware that failed, and the complexity of the labor involved. For example, replacing a single heavy-duty spring is a different job than repairing a damaged track or an opener motor that has burned out. About this service

A garage door seal is the rubber or vinyl stripping that runs along the bottom and sides of your door to keep out drafts, moisture, and pests. What are garage door torsion springs?

Garage door torsion springs are heavy-duty springs mounted above the garage door that help lift and lower it. They store significant energy and are crucial for safe operation. If they break, the door becomes very difficult or impossible to lift manually. We offer free estimates for replacement.

What is a wall mount garage door opener?

A wall mount garage door opener, also known as a jackshaft opener, mounts directly to the torsion spring shaft. It's an excellent space-saving solution for garages with low headroom in Houston. These openers are also very quiet. We offer free estimates for their installation.

What are chain drive garage door openers?

Chain drive garage door openers use a chain to move the trolley along the opener rail. They are known for their durability and power, making them a popular choice for Houston homes. While they can be a bit noisier than belt drives, they are very reliable. We offer free estimates for installation.

What are garage door sensors and what do they do?

Garage door sensors are safety devices located near the bottom of the garage door track. They emit an invisible beam; if something breaks the beam while the door is closing, the door will reverse to prevent injury or damage. They are essential for safe operation.
